Through the development of an online clothing donation platform, Giving Factory Direct in 2021, C2C also serves children in NYC and San Francisco. The organization has Cradles to Crayons drop off locations in Massachusetts, Pennsylvania, and Illinois. The new and gently used children's clothing donations go to support families and children in need.

It began by gathering and supplying food for local disaster victims and holding weekly "quilting bees" to make blankets for them. Plenty's most notable early project was its four-year presence in the Guatemalan highlands after the earthquake of 1976 , helping to rebuild 1,200 houses and lay 27 kilometers (17 miles) of waterpipe.

A vintage Pendleton Woolen Mills blanket under a mosquito net The company began to expand their product line into other woolen textile products and later into apparel. In 1912 the company opened a weaving mill in Washougal, Washington (across the Columbia River from Portland) for the production of woolen fabrics used in suits and other clothing.
